Bold and Beautiful: Transform Your Space with Color

When it comes to accent walls, bold colors are the ultimate showstoppers. A single wall painted in a striking hue can instantly draw the eye and create a focal point in your living room. The key is to choose a color that complements your existing decor while still standing out. Bold colors don’t just add personality—they also set the tone for the entire room. Whether you want drama, energy, or elegance, the right color can make it happen.

Idea #1: Deep Navy Blue

Go for a deep navy blue. This color is perfect for creating a modern, sophisticated vibe. Pair it with white trim and metallic accents like gold or brass light fixtures for a polished look. Add a large abstract painting or a gallery wall to complete the design, and watch as your living room transforms into a chic retreat.

Idea #2: Fiery Red

If you’re feeling adventurous, try a fiery red like Sherwin-Williams’ “Real Red.” This bold choice works beautifully in eclectic or bohemian spaces. Balance the intensity with neutral furniture and natural textures like a jute rug or wooden coffee table, creating a warm and inviting atmosphere.

How to Choose the Perfect Color for Your Living Room Accent Wall

Choosing the right color for your accent wall can feel overwhelming, but it doesn’t have to be. The trick is to think about the mood you want to create and how the color will interact with the rest of your space. Remember, the goal is cohesion. Your accent wall should enhance the overall design of your living room, not clash with it.

Idea #3: Soft Sage Green

For a calming, serene vibe, try a soft sage green. This color pairs beautifully with natural wood tones and plenty of greenery. Add some cozy throw pillows in neutral tones to tie the look together, creating a peaceful oasis in your home.

Idea #4: Vibrant Jewel Tones

If you want to energize your space, go for a vibrant jewel tone like emerald green or sapphire blue. These colors work especially well in rooms with lots of natural light. Keep the rest of the room neutral to let the accent wall shine, making it the star of the show.

Small Living Rooms, Big Impact: Accent Wall Ideas for Compact Spaces

If you’re working with a small living room, don’t worry—accent walls can actually make your space feel larger and more dynamic. The key is to use color and design strategically to create the illusion of depth. Accent walls in small spaces are all about maximizing visual interest without overwhelming the room.

Idea #5: Vertical Stripes

Vertical stripes are a great way to make a small room feel taller. Use two complementary colors, like light gray and white, to create a subtle yet impactful design. This trick draws the eye upward, making the ceiling feel higher and the space more open.

Idea #6: Light Gray with White Trim

Choose a light gray as your accent wall color, which provides a sophisticated backdrop while keeping the room feeling open. Pair it with crisp white trim to create sharp contrast and enhance brightness. This combination works well with a variety of decor styles. Add lively accents, such as colorful curtains or artwork, to inject personality while retaining the airy vibe of the room.

Big, Open Floor Plan Solutions: Defining Spaces with Color

Open floor plans are fantastic for creating a sense of flow, but they can sometimes feel a little too open. An accent wall is a great way to define different areas within a larger space. By using color to define spaces, you can create a sense of structure and intimacy in even the largest rooms.

Idea #7: Dark Charcoal Gray

Use a dark, moody color like charcoal gray to anchor your living room seating area. Add a large piece of artwork or a statement mirror to make the wall a true focal point, creating a cozy nook that invites relaxation.

Idea #8: Warm Terracotta

To separate your dining area, try a warm terracotta shade like Sherwin-Williams’ “Copper Wire.” Pair it with natural wood furniture and black metal accents for a cohesive, modern look that seamlessly ties the two spaces together.

The Impact of Patterns: Using Stenciling or Murals for Accent Walls

Why settle for a plain wall when you can turn it into a piece of art? Patterns, stencils, and murals are fantastic ways to add personality and creativity to your living room. Patterns and murals are all about making a statement. They’re bold, unique, and guaranteed to impress.

Idea #9: Geometric Stencil Pattern

Try a geometric stencil pattern in metallic gold over a matte black wall. This creates a luxurious, art-deco-inspired look that’s perfect for modern or eclectic spaces. Add a velvet sofa and some vintage decor to complete the vibe, making your living room a true conversation starter.

Idea #10: Abstract Mural

For a more organic feel, go with an abstract mural in shades of blue and green. This works especially well in coastal or nature-inspired interiors. Add decor like driftwood sculptures and glass vases to tie the theme together, creating a harmonious and inviting atmosphere.

Supporting a Theme: Make Your Accent Wall Tell a Story

A themed accent wall can take your living room to the next level. Whether you’re dreaming of a tropical escape or a cozy cabin retreat, your accent wall can set the tone for the entire room. Themed accent walls are not just about aesthetics; they’re a fantastic way to express your personality and make your living room feel truly unique. They invite conversation, spark joy, and create a memorable atmosphere for you and your guests.

Idea #11: Jungle Oasis

Imagine stepping into a lush, vibrant rain forest right from your living room! Create a jungle-inspired wall with rich emerald green paint and stenciled leaves in lighter tones to mimic the play of light through foliage. This rich hue serves as a stunning backdrop that instantly energizes the space. To complete the look, incorporate rattan furniture for that organic touch, add wicker baskets for storage, and fill the room with plenty of tropical plants like monstera or palms. Consider hanging a large, framed botanical print or a macramé plant hanger to accentuate the theme even further.

Idea #12: Coastal Escape

For those longing for the soothing vibes of the beach, a coastal accent wall can transport you to a serene shore. Paint your wall a soft sandy beige and add horizontal white stripes to create a nautical feel reminiscent of beach houses. To bring the theme to life, decorate with seashells collected from your favorite beach, incorporate rope accents for an authentic maritime touch, and use navy blue throw pillows that echo the colors of the ocean. You can even add a driftwood-inspired shelf to hold decorative items like lanterns and nautical-themed books.
